ShadowProtect v4.1.0 Released
Click here to get the v4.1.0 Desktop Installer. If running version 3.x or 4.0, no need to uninstall old version. Bear in mind that if you do wish to uninstall the old version, then deactivate BEFORE uninstalling. You can then reactivate after the update. If you uninstall before deactivating, your new install will be considered a trial version and you will not be allowed to enter your serial number without contacting the Support Group.
Click here to get the ISO Recovery image. You will need a valid serial number to gain access to the download. The ISO download is really the Download Manager. Suggest you download the DLM, save to your desktop and then run it. The full size ISO is a zipped file >357MB.
Please note: going to the above links and downloading does NOT impact your download "count". If you sign into your account and use the links in that area, your count(s) will be reduced.
There is a ReadMe.RTF file included in the ISO Documentation folder that shows what changes were included. I have converted the ReadMe.RTF file to PDF format and have attached it to this message.
The User Guide can be found in the ISO Documentation folder. Or, go to the first link above, open up the Desktop menu and select the User guide.

The previous version, 4.0.5 ISO file, had the Image Manager included. This time around, for 4.1.0, the Image Manager is a separate download.
So the first link in my previous message above will also give you access to the Image Manager. I should have known when I saw that the new 4.1.0 ISO file is quite smaller than the previous.
